A late excursion in the last hour before sunset from the MacKenzie-King Estate down trail 7 to the Champlain Parkway and back. The trail had been groomed and track set that morning. Large, wet snowflakes were falling as we skied, giving a little stickiness or resistance to the uphill. Snow ploughing downhill was soft and slow with a slight crunchiness of ice underneath.

On the way back we met a couple walking in the middle of the track and politely told them it wasn't allowed. They might have just taken a wrong turning from the snow shoe trail. We didn't stay to find out!

It was very beautiful in the fading light with the snow falling and the ice still adhering to the trees.

Gatineau Park is ski paradise! The network of ski trails offer machine groomed skate skiing and classic skiing as well as little groomed backcountry trails. Multiple access points allow skiers to access a variety of terrain and scenery. The NCC offers season or daily pay rates.
